Filters:
clear
Country: Cuba

boutique hotel in Camaguey

About 4 results.

Hotel Camaguey

Carretera Central Este, 70100 Camagüey, Cuba

Hotel Plaza

Gran Hotel by Melia Hotels

Calle Maceo 64, 70100 Camagüey, Cuba
  • 1